Balmoral Avenue is in Beckenham and in Bromley district. BR3 3RD is located in the Kelsey & Eden Park elect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Beckenham.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Balmoral Avenue Street d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Balmoral Avenue was 130.9 per 1,000 residents, which is 119.3% higher than the Clock House average. The most reported crime type was Other theft.

Balmoral Avenue has the 12th highest crime rate of 66 local areas in Clock House and the 150th highest crime rate of 930 local areas in Bromley .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 50.9 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has risen by about 23.1%.
